Transaction 50830fafd7028d87e0a433e15d69fcffec53e4e03e7309d01cc89a1ba6de772f
1 Input
1 Output
-
50830fafd7028d87e0a433e15d69fcffec53e4e03e7309d01cc89a1ba6de772f:0
- value
- 159080168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c36b38e3bb5a57ad7baef50144f619c5ec7b2865 OP_EQUAL
- address
- 3KWJ8t5Yi93kTNeXeNr161qsxFGVqtFG84